InterTradeIreland: Who Qualifies and What You Get
Learn how small and medium businesses can access expert advice and funding to grow their trade across the island of Ireland.
InterTradeIreland provides support for businesses looking to grow through increased trade across the island of Ireland.
Who it's for
This scheme is designed for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) that are actively trading across the border between the North and the South.
What you get
You can access professional advice to help navigate the complexities of cross-border commerce. Depending on the specific program available, you may also be eligible for funding to support your business expansion.
What it costs you
There is no general fee to access information, but you will need to go through a formal application process to qualify for specific funding programs.
The catch to know
The support is very specific: it focuses exclusively on North-South trade. If your business goals do not involve trading across the border on the island of Ireland, this scheme will not be relevant to you.
